Hypnea wynnei and Hypnea yokoyana (Cystocloniaceae, Rhodophyta), two new species revealed by a DNA barcoding survey on the Brazilian coast
- 1. Universidade de São Paulo, Instituto de Biociências, Departamento de Botânica. Rua do Matão, 277, Cidade Universitária, 05508-090 - São Paulo, SP - Brazil
Description
Nauer, Fabio, Cassano, Valéria, Oliveira, Mariana C. (2016): Hypnea wynnei and Hypnea yokoyana (Cystocloniaceae, Rhodophyta), two new species revealed by a DNA barcoding survey on the Brazilian coast. Phytotaxa 268 (2): 123-134, DOI: 10.11646/phytotaxa.268.2.3, URL: http://dx.doi.org/10.11646/phytotaxa.268.2.3
